World Aids Day Special: The HIV Vaccination Trial

Where are we at with the creation of a preventative HIV vaccination and what is the groundbreaking science involved? How have previous depictions of AIDS and HIV shaped our misconceptions when it comes to the virus? Today we answer these questions with Professor Marta Boffito, the clinical research lead of a new vaccination trial, and Dan Harry, a trial participant who rose to fame through his participation in this year’s I Kissed A Boy.  📍Sign up for an HIV vaccination trial here 📍 ...

257: Trans Awareness Week: Schuyler Bailar/ pinkmantaray | Part 2

Back in 2015, today’s guest Schuyler Bailar made headlines for being the first openly transgender athlete to compete in a US Division 1 National sports team. Since then, Schuyler has been named as one the most influential Trans activists and his Instagram (pinkmantaray) documenting his transition has helped educate trans and cis people all over the world. This is a beautiful chat about the intersectionality of being half Korean, trans and living in America, the importance of trans inclusion in s...
